Long Beach, Calif., enacts ban on plastic bags

WASHINGTON (May 18, 2:25 p.m. ET) -- Long Beach, Calif., has become the eighth community to enact a plastic bag ban this year, bringing the number of bans in the United States to 22.

In addition, two communities, Washington, D.C., and Montgomery County, Md. - which passed its ban earlier this month -- each have a 5-cent tax on plastic and paper carryout bags.

The Long Beach ban on plastic, compostable plastic, and degradable plastic bags was passed unanimously May 17. It will go into effect Aug. 1 for grocery stores and pharmacies with at least 10,000 square feet or annual sales of $2 million or more.

That’s one month after a similar ban on single-use carryout bags will go into effect for unincorporated areas of Los Angeles County. The law also places a 10-cent tax for each paper carryout bag handed out by retailers.

Are reusable grocery bags that are made and shipped from China really just missing the point of reusable bags?

justin h asked: ok, so tonight I was at wal-mart and was common to buy some reusable grocery bags, then I thought I better see where these bags were made, b/c wal-mart loves China, sure enough, made in China. In doubt #1: Do any of these grocery stores have reusable bags that are made in the USA? answer choices: Albertson's, Ralph's, Von's, Whole Food, Broker Joe's? If you don't know then don't answer this part, but please offer answers/opinions on the next part.

Second part, doesn't buying reusable grocery bags that are shipped from China, resulting in whacking great amounts of pollution being released in transit via gasoline use really just worst the purpose? I mean, if you are using reusable grocery bags to help the environment, protect marine soul/birds/animals, and to negate the petroleum that is used to make plastic bags, then isn't shipping the bags from China missing the underscore?

If Wal-Mart (and other retailers) are worried about the environment (vs. making money off the bags, and saving cold hard cash by buying less plastic bags) then why wouldn't they be buying/shipping the bags from local (meaning US) companies?

By the skin of one's teeth so everyone knows I think reusable bags are great and really want to start using them, but I'm having a intent time getting past the fact that the bags are made in China and shipped to the US resulting in as likely as not more pollution and evironmental damage than we'd be comfortable with. (Don't even get me started on the American job loss light). Thanks for your answers in advance.

whsgreenmom answered: Very upright question. I didn't really think about where the reusable bags I use come from. I can tell you I got most from ecobags.com and from heterogeneous grocery stores, but I never checked to see where they were made.

I don't think that buying a bag made in China defeats the purpose. Yes, there are shipping costs active in getting them to the store, but there are also shipping costs to get disposable bags to the store. I think a cull trip from China would out weight hundreds of trips from around the US for the disposable bags. I know before I switched I could undoubtedly bring 10-15 bags a week into my home. Now, I have many reusable bags and I'm down to 2-3 a month.

I don't think Walmart and many of the other chains are uneasy about the environment. They are just trying to capture retail dollars. Marketing departments across the world see the trend to being more ecofriendly and they want all those green dollars in their registers. I don't think that is a bad id. Walmart may be motivated by the bottom line, but they are doing a lot of good by it.

Here are a few changes they've made: They only stock concentrated laudry purifying- this reduces transportation costs and conserves fuel, they partnered with coke a cola to get to a line of recycled plastic t-shirts, they have made a commitment to reduce their electric bill and will be installing solar panels on some stores and implementing verve saving measures at other stores. I applaud them for making the changes.

Reusable grocery bags- How do your you remember to bring yours?

tammy f asked: Remembering to do your bags seems to be a big issue. To be completely honest, I sell reusable grocery bags and I would like to have some tips to give to my customers. What works and what doesn't. It is hoped by being honest I can get some good answers.

undir answered: I have two in general ones and I keep them in my car. I usually just use one at a time, so there's usually at least one in the car at any given time. After I talk about the groceries home and take them out of the bag I put the bag near the door so that I'll remember to take it with me to my car when I leave to work the next day. That way, even if I necessary to make an unplanned trip to the grocery store I have a bag in my car.

It only takes a few times to get used to this boring. I don't have to give those bags much thought anymore, I just take them with me as a matter of routine.
